Transaction 08a641a7024011fedd8bcab5a79693acea166cb59b7b08372001b76c9318edbe

1 Input
1 Outputs
  • 08a641a7024011fedd8bcab5a79693acea166cb59b7b08372001b76c9318edbe:0
  • value  190779
    address  3KjRY3MApzYNCrqmeLroFvg8Ne4xMFLZxw